53: Chapter Fifty-Three

We left the Zach’s residence and went to our mansion to talk with dad. I was anxious on the whole ride. I feel like talking with dad would be tougher than dealing with the kidnappers.
Minutes later we arrived. I saw dad as soon as I entered the house.
“Dad—”
“I saw the broadcast, and you know my answer. Also, if you’re going to pay that ten million, make sure not to get it from the company.”
See? See what kind of man he is?! I wanted to shout, curse and call him names but I have to control my anger knowing that I’m asking him a favor.
“Dad, I know you don’t care about Aviana. You never cared about us, your own children, so why would you care for your granddaughter? I know—”
“You’re the one asking me a favor but you dare talk to me like that?!”
“Sir, please... we want to bring our daughter back,” Cameron pled.
“Then think of another way. It’s your responsibility as parents.” I lost it. I laughed as I glare at him.
“Responsibility as parents? Who are you to say that to us when you never knew or did that?! What did I expect from you? You can even sell us if it means saving your reputation.”
“Stephen! I’ll do deals with S&H as long as you get my granddaughter alive and safe,” Cameron’s dad said but my dad did not budge.
“It could be trap like what happened on the warehouse! What’s the use of those deals if I can die in there?!”
“How could you be so cold hearted?! There’s a child in danger! Most importantly, it’s your granddaughter!” Mom shouted angrily.
“Dad, Casterdale is watching us. If you don’t show up, won’t you turn out to be the villain for them? Your reputation will reach rock bottom if Aviana dies.” What Sylvester said changed the expression of dad.
“Syl is right dad, you will lose everything you’ve worked hard for if something happens to her,” Skyler adds.
“Nothing can change my mind. I can’t die right now, especially that my own father is sick. If something happens to me, how can I be so sure that you will take care of your grandfather? You hate him just like how you hate me.”
“Is hate even the right word? We despise you,” Sylvester said.
“Think of another plan.” I suddenly received a message and read it out loud.
“You have one hour. Savannah, leave the money at the nursery room at CDL Hospital. Your father has to go to Norths Hospital to pick your daughter. Don’t be late, you know the rules. Also, don’t bring any security team or police if you don’t want your daughter to be harmed.”
I heard multiple sighs as I finish reading the text. I looked at dad but he just shook his head as he speaks.
“I’m not going. Your daughter is not my responsibility.” He was about to walk away, but I kneeled and held his hand.
“Savannah! Stand up!” I heard my mom shouting. My brothers are also telling me to stand up but I did not listen. Kneeling down is something I never did but I will do it for the sake of my daughter.
“I-I know we were never in good terms.” I looked up to him with teary eyes. “But I beg you... I’m begging you, p-please save my daughter. P-please... get her back. I will do anything you say! I will do everything! Just please get my daughter back. I’m begging you.”
Suddenly, Cameron kneeled beside me. His father loudly shouted but he did not move.
“Sir, I’m begging you. Please save our daughter. I will pay you or do anything, just please save our daughter.”
“Cameron! You stand up this instant!” His dad tried to pull him up but he still did not move.
“Sir! Please, we need your help. We need our daughter back. I’ll compensate you with the best I can. Also, don’t worry because we’ll have the security team to spectate you from afar and make sure you’re safe.”
A moment of silence filled the whole room, until Stefano broke it.
“Save my niece. I never did anything against your will. I always did whatever you want. I never asked you for anything. Just this once, I’m asking you to save my niece. Save Aviana.”
I bowed my head in despair. The time is running and we’re only given one hour.
I heard a deep sighed before a voice speaking.
“Tell them to prepare the money... and the car.” I quickly lifted my head and smiled.
“Thank you—”
“Don’t thank me yet. Also, stand up you two. A Harris and a Zach kneeling isn’t ideal for a prestigious family like ours.”
He walked away and Cameron assisted me as we stand up. They started preparing the cash money and I also prepared to leave.
“Isn’t this the hospital where I gave birth to Sylvester?” Mom suddenly asked.
“It’s downtown, why did you give birth there?” Stefano confusingly asked.
“I was on business trip and I went there. It was an emergency labor so they brought be there. You, Savannah and Skyler are all born in CDL. But I heard it stopped operating only two years after I gave birth to Vester.”
“I’m always the outsider.”
“This is not the time for drama, Sylvester.”
“Then is that hospital abandoned now?!” Dad asked. “This is dangerous we should—”
“Stephen! Be the man of your words for once! Get your granddaughter out of there!” Mom loudly shouted.
We didn’t take long and we left. Dad and I went to our respective locations.
The hospital was busy and I had to make sure to hide my identity. I am alert as I take every step towards the nursery room. I went inside and there wasn’t any nurse, it’s only the newborn babies. I placed two black bags with the money on the floor and was about to leave but two men, dressing like a nurse and doctor, entered. One man pointed a gun on me and the other closed the blinds in the windows.
“We’ll let you leave after we count the money. Just to make sure that you are not toying with us.”
“W-Why would we do that when my daughter’s life is in danger?!”
“Good point, but madam has trust issues... especially to a Harris.” The other man started opening the bags and counting the money.
“Who is your boss—”
“Don’t ask anything... if you want to get out of here alive.”
“We’re at the hospital, I can get immediate medica—”
“Not when I shoot you on your head.” I flinched when he pointed the gun closer and harder at my head. Maybe that wasn’t appropriate to say in this situation. “Madam was right about you, you’re the most fearless and toughest Harris to exist.”
“What does she have—”
“I said do not ask!” He shouted as he presses the gun harder at my head. I’m seriously shaking and scared for my life.
“Sir, the money is complete,” said by the other man. They brought the bags and left the room. As soon as the door closes, I held on a table when I almost lost my balance.
Oh, gosh I thought I was going to die.
